Understanding what a misfire means for your engine
An engine misfire occurs when one or more cylinders fail to ignite the air-fuel mixture properly. That can cause rough idle, reduced power, higher fuel consumption, and increased emissions. Left unchecked, a misfire can damage catalytic converters and downstream sensors, and in some cases lead to dangerous drivability issues. Identifying the root cause quickly is key to deciding whether repair is practical.
Common causes and how they’re diagnosed
Common causes range from simple wear items to sensor or wiring faults. Diagnosing a misfire typically starts with reading diagnostic trouble codes (OBD-II), examining cylinder-specific data, and then testing components in the order of likelihood and cost.
- Worn, fouled, or incorrectly gapped spark plugs
- Faulty ignition coils or coil packs
- Clogged or failing fuel injectors or fuel delivery issues
- Vacuum leaks or intake leaks (cracked hoses, gasket leaks)
- Dirty or failing mass air flow (MAF) or other air intake sensors
- Faulty oxygen sensors or catalytic converter issues causing improper fuel trim
- Low compression due to engine wear, head gasket problems, or valve issues
- Electrical wiring faults or a failing engine control unit (ECU/PCM)
Knowing the exact cause guides whether a fix is straightforward or signals a deeper engine issue. Some misfires are intermittent and inexpensive to fix, while others indicate costly mechanical problems.
Costs and value: when to repair vs replace
Repair costs for a misfire vary widely based on the root cause, engine design, and local labor rates. A misfire on a modern car can often be resolved with affordable fixes, but some root causes are expensive and may influence whether repair is the best financial choice.
Typical repair costs by cause
The following ranges reflect common pricing and can vary by location and shop. They help you estimate whether repair aligns with your vehicle’s value and life expectancy.
- Spark plug replacement (per cylinder or as a full set): typically $100–$300 per cylinder, or about $250–$650 for a full set on a multi-cylinder engine
- Ignition coil replacement (per coil or coil pack): typically $120–$450 per coil; a full set for newer engines can run $350–$1,200
- Fuel injector cleaning or replacement: cleaning $50–$150; injector replacement $150–$600 per injector, depending on vehicle
- Fuel system issues (pump, regulator, high-pressure rail): $300–$1,000+ for pump-related repairs; costs rise with complexity and access
- Vacuum leaks and intake gasket repairs: small leaks $50–$200; major gasket jobs $200–$1,000+
- Sensors (MAF/MAP, O2 sensors): $150–$400 per sensor plus diagnostic time
- Engine mechanical issues (compression problems, head gasket, timing): repairs can range from $1,000 to several thousand; severe cases may require engine replacement
In many cases, addressing a misfire is prudent if the vehicle still has meaningful value and the repair budget is reasonable. If repair costs approach the car’s current value or you’re facing multiple failures, replacing the vehicle may be a smarter financial move.
Safety and performance considerations
Driving with a misfiring engine can be unsafe and may cause long-term damage. A misfire reduces power, can cause stalling, and increases emissions, potentially leading to failed inspections. Repeated misfires can overheat and damage the catalytic converter and oxygen sensors, resulting in more expensive repairs. If a misfire is severe or accompanied by other warning signs, limit driving and seek professional diagnostics promptly.
How to proceed: steps to take now
If you detect a misfire, follow these practical steps to determine whether repair is worth pursuing and to plan an effective fix.
- Check the dashboard for warning lights and pull codes with an OBD-II scanner to identify whether the misfire is random (P0300) or cylinder-specific (P0301–P0308).
- Note symptoms: idle quality, acceleration, fuel economy, smell of fuel, and whether the misfire occurs at idle or under load.
- Prioritize safety: if the vehicle feels unstable or the misfire worsens, stop driving and seek immediate help.
- Consult a qualified technician for targeted diagnostics, including spark plugs, ignition coils, fuel delivery, vacuum lines, and compression testing if needed.
- Obtain a written estimate that itemizes parts and labor, then weigh the cost against your vehicle’s value and expected remaining life.
Following a structured diagnostic process helps you decide whether to fix, trade in, or replace. If the context is favorable, repairing is usually the prudent choice; otherwise, consider alternatives.
